1. Do swimming and exercise affect breast size?
Yes, intense physical activity can affect breast size. Swimming is a high-intensity sport that involves repetitive arm movements and a rigorous full-body workout. This can lead to a decrease in body fat percentage, including the fat stored in breast tissue.

3. Can swimming affect breast development in young swimmers?
Intense training from a young age can delay puberty in some female swimmers, which may impact breast development. However, it is important to note that this is not the case for all swimmers.
4. Are there any hormonal factors at play?
Hormones play a crucial role in breast development. Intense training can affect hormone levels, potentially leading to a delay in breast growth or smaller breast size in some female swimmers.

6. Are there any advantages to having smaller breasts in swimming?
Smaller breasts create less drag in the water, allowing swimmers to move more efficiently and quickly.
